Brandt s Hamster vs Costa Central Oryzomys
Mesocricetus brandti compared with Nephelomys caracolus
Key Differences
- Brandt s Hamster is Near Threatened while Costa Central Oryzomys is Least Concern.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Brandt s Hamster | Costa Central Oryzomys |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(脊索動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class same | Mammalia (哺乳類) | Mammalia (哺乳類) |
| Order same | Rodentia (ネズミ目) | Rodentia (ネズミ目) |
| Family same | Cricetidae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Mesocricetus | Nephelomys |
| Species | Mesocricetus brandti | Nephelomys caracolus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Brandt s Hamster and Costa Central Oryzomys share a common ancestor at the Family level: Cricetidae.
